> Add support for matching on ICMP type and code to flower. This is modeled
> on existing support for matching on L4 ports.
>
> The second patch provided a minor cleanup which is in keeping with
> they style used in the last patch.
>
> This is marked as an RFC to match the same designation given to the
> corresponding kernel patches.
